F1 to have FOUR fan festivals this year!
It has been confirmed that Formula 1 will hold four more fan festival events throughout 2019 - according to RaceFans. This is in addition to the Season Launch that was announced on Tuesday. Shanghai will be the first city to host a fan festival - which will take place in the build-up to the 1000th world championship - which is this year's China Grand Prix (April 14th). USA will host two of the fan festivals - the first being in Chicago, Illinois during the build-up to the Candadian Grand Prix.
